Of the Bay Area’s 10 most expensive home sales of 2024, half were in one city

5. 275 Camino Al Lago, Atherton | $29M

Palo Alto-based NexGen Builders sold this 11,300-square-foot new-build in West Atherton in June 2024. According to property records, the buyer was Stellar Prosperity LLC, a company affiliated with Luxshare Tech, a major Chinese supplier for Apple products, and whose technology is also used in AI data centers. The company’s cofounder is Wang Laichun, who in 2021 ranked as the second-richest woman in China.

The listing agent, Nathalie de Saint Andrieu, said that she couldn’t disclose the buyer, but said that the listing attracted several people working in tech, as well as foreign buyers. She said that the home’s appeal was its “quiet luxury” feel, in which “the quality and elegance of the home took precedence over the ‘stuff.'”

Rolex, ICA SF and Wilkes Bashford Debut New Spaces

Kerns San Francisco Rolex Showroom

255 Post Street, San Francisco; kernjewelers.com

In partnership with Kerns Fine Jewelry, Rolex’s stunning showroom is now open in downtown San Francisco. “Watch lovers can look forward to an inviting, comfortable atmosphere filled with fantastic models from throughout the Rolex collection,” says David Mendell, proprietor of Kerns. “One of my favorite themes of the showroom is the recurring usage of the iconic fluted motif. It is highlighted on the walls, in the cabinetry and, of course, on many of the watches, too. Another showstopper is the custom Lasvit chandelier that represents a deconstructed view of the layers of a Rolex watch.” The shop’s opening coincides with Kerns’ 50th anniversary as an official Rolex jeweler, so it’s a full-circle moment for the Burlingame-based brand. While Rolex doesn’t produce limited collections for a specific location, the Kerns team has access to rare, one-of-a-kind pieces, and their collection of watches changes regularly. For the best experience, the team recommends making an appointment.
